Welcome to the Sparks Middle School TEAM-UP 21st Century Community Learning Center!
Our Purpose is:
To provide a safe and caring environment where students can learn and work toward proficiency or better in reading/language arts and mathematics.
To enable all students to succeed as individuals and citizens by teaching them positive behavior and life skills.
To encourage adult family members to take a more active role in the education process - - their student’s as well as their own education
The 21st Century Community Learning Center program provides academic enrichment opportunities during non-school hours for students. The focus is on fun and engaging activities that students will enjoy doing yet still be learning and mastering skills that give them trouble during the regular school day. The class sizes for the 21st CCLC program are much smaller giving the teacher the greater freedom to tailor his/her instruction to the needs of the small group.
